hiya all, i have irtrans working with an mce remote.
it was quite easy actually
1) make sure the irtrans software is installed, and make sure the driver is installed (check in device manager) check the irtrans icon in the process tray blinks as you press the buttons on the remote
2) download Event Ghost
3) run eventghost, click file / new to get rid of the winamp shit, also clear log to make it easier to see
4) add the XBMC plugin
5) add the lirc plugin (if i recall correctly, default values are good)
6) pressing buttons on the remote should now cause things to appear in the list on the left of event ghost
7) drag and drop these "buttons" into the XBMC actions on the right side of event ghost
8) boot xbmc with event ghost running... all should be working fine?
For info.... the up, down, left, right, select, and number buttons natively work in xbmc, now event ghost is supposed to (i think) stop these getting through, but it doesnt seem to happen, so if you link those in eventghost too, then each button press will happen twice,
...so just leave the up, down, left, right, select, and number buttons alone, and set up all the other buttons in eventghost
USE THE LIRC PLUGIN NOT THE MCE PLUGIN
